Output 317257915964645287b77ad1b2ea06fab1a8c5679ce0e08fad7177f52e523c32:2

value
945223
script pubkey
OP_0 OP_PUSHBYTES_20 c1c3c6b3edb852c85246fdc8810375b35d3d9dc6
address
bc1qc8pudvldhpfvs5jxlhygzqm4kdwnm8wxkcwndj
transaction
317257915964645287b77ad1b2ea06fab1a8c5679ce0e08fad7177f52e523c32
confirmations
261097
spent
true